Category: Technology
- Test post ()
This is a test post This is a test post This is a test post
- Internet Networks per Capita ()
In response to our recent post about the history of Internet network number assignments, Andy Davidson asked an interesting question via Twitter – what would this look like on a per capita basis? Very different indeed is the answer! (You may need to reload this page in your browser to see the animation below.) This […]